Android视频通话是否支持背景模糊?

随着移动互联网的快速发展,视频通话已经成为人们日常生活中不可或缺的一部分。在众多视频通话应用中,Android系统以其庞大的用户群体和丰富的应用生态而备受关注。然而,对于Android视频通话是否支持背景模糊这一问题,不少用户仍然存在疑惑。本文将针对这一问题进行详细解答。

一、Android视频通话背景模糊的技术原理

背景模糊技术,又称为背景虚化或背景模糊化,主要是通过图像处理算法实现的一种视觉效果。在视频通话中,背景模糊技术可以有效地将通话者从复杂的背景中分离出来,使画面更加简洁、美观。

目前,Android视频通话背景模糊技术主要基于以下几种原理:

  1. 深度信息提取:通过摄像头采集的视频画面,提取出前景和背景的深度信息。深度信息是指物体在空间中的距离信息,有助于区分前景和背景。

  2. 图像分割:根据深度信息,将视频画面分割成前景和背景两部分。前景部分包含通话者,背景部分则包含其他物体。

  3. 背景模糊处理:对分割出的背景部分进行模糊处理,使背景变得模糊不清,从而突出通话者。

  4. 画面合成:将处理后的背景与前景重新合成,形成最终的背景模糊效果。

二、Android视频通话背景模糊的实现方式

目前,Android视频通话背景模糊的实现方式主要有以下几种:

  1. 硬件加速:部分Android手机搭载的摄像头支持硬件加速功能,可以直接在硬件层面实现背景模糊效果。这种方式的优点是速度快、功耗低,但受限于硬件支持。

  2. 软件算法:通过软件算法实现背景模糊效果,不受硬件限制。常见的软件算法有OpenCV、MediaCodec等。这种方式可以实现多种背景模糊效果,但处理速度和功耗相对较高。

  3. 第三方应用:部分第三方视频通话应用支持背景模糊功能,如腾讯会议、Zoom等。这些应用通过调用系统API或第三方库实现背景模糊效果。

三、Android视频通话背景模糊的优缺点

  1. 优点:

(1)美化画面:背景模糊可以有效地将通话者从复杂的背景中分离出来,使画面更加简洁、美观。

(2)保护隐私:在公共场合进行视频通话时,背景模糊可以避免泄露个人隐私。

(3)提高通话质量:背景模糊可以降低背景噪声对通话质量的影响。


  1. 缺点:

(1)硬件限制:部分Android手机不支持硬件加速,导致背景模糊效果较差。

(2)功耗较高:软件算法实现的背景模糊效果,处理速度和功耗相对较高。

(3)兼容性问题:部分第三方应用可能存在兼容性问题,导致背景模糊功能无法正常使用。

四、总结

综上所述,Android视频通话背景模糊技术在实际应用中具有一定的优势,但同时也存在一些限制。随着技术的不断发展,相信未来会有更多Android手机支持硬件加速,以及更加高效的软件算法,为用户提供更好的背景模糊效果。而对于用户而言,在选择视频通话应用时,可以根据自己的需求和设备性能,选择合适的背景模糊功能。

猜你喜欢:环信即时推送